当前位置: 首页 > news >正文

初创公司 建网站济南seo外包服务

初创公司 建网站,济南seo外包服务,去国外做赌钱网站,wordpress设置图标Python实现读取Excel数据详细教学版 在处理数据和进行数据分析时,Excel文件是常见的数据载体。通过Python读取Excel数据,可以方便地对数据进行进一步的处理和分析。以下将详细介绍使用Python读取Excel数据的方法和相关库的使用,并提供具体代…

Python实现读取Excel数据详细教学版

在处理数据和进行数据分析时,Excel文件是常见的数据载体。通过Python读取Excel数据,可以方便地对数据进行进一步的处理和分析。以下将详细介绍使用Python读取Excel数据的方法和相关库的使用,并提供具体代码示例。

一、准备工作

  1. 安装必要的库

- pandas:用于数据处理和分析的核心库,支持多种格式的数据文件。
   - openpyxl:为pandas提供读取.xlsx文件的引擎。

可以通过pip命令安装这两个库:
   bash    pip install pandas openpyxl    

  1. 基础概念

- DataFrame:Pandas中的二维表格型数据结构,具有行索引和列索引。
   - Series:一维的标签数组,可以存储任何数据类型。

二、读取Excel数据

  1. 读取单个工作表

- 使用pd.read_excel()方法从Excel文件中读取一个工作表。

```python
     import pandas as pd

# 读取’Sheet1’工作表
     df = pd.read_excel(‘example.xlsx’, sheet_name=‘Sheet1’)

# 显示前5行数据
     print(df.head())

# 查看DataFrame的信息
     print(df.info())
     ```

  1. 使用特定的列

- 有时只需要Excel中的某些列,可以使用usecols参数指定要读取的列。

```python
     # 读取’Name’和’Age’列
     df = pd.read_excel(‘example.xlsx’, sheet_name=‘Sheet1’, usecols=[‘Name’, ‘Age’])

# 显示数据
     print(df)
     ```

  1. 读取多个工作表

- 如果Excel文件中有多个工作表,可以使用pd.ExcelFile来读取所有工作表。

```python
     from pandas import ExcelFile

# 创建ExcelFile对象
     xls = ExcelFile(‘example.xlsx’)

# 获取所有工作表名称
     sheet_names = xls.sheet_names
     print(“工作表列表:”, sheet_names)

# 读取所有工作表
     sheets = {name: xls.parse(name) for name in sheet_names}
     for name, df in sheets.items():
         print(f"工作表 ‘{name}’😊
         print(df.head())
     ```

  1. 自定义日期解析

- 如果Excel文件中包含日期数据,可以使用parse_dates参数自动转换日期格式。

```python
     # 将’Date’列解析为日期
     df = pd.read_excel(‘example.xlsx’, sheet_name=‘Sheet1’, parse_dates=[‘Date’])

# 显示数据
     print(df[‘Date’])
     ```

  1. 处理缺失值

- Excel文件中可能存在缺失值,pandas会将其识别为NaN。可以使用fillna方法填充这些缺失值。

```python
     # 用0填充缺失值
     df_filled = df.fillna(0)

# 显示处理后的数据
     print(df_filled)
     ```

  1. 数据类型转换

- 有时需要转换数据框中的数据类型,例如将字符串转换为数字。

```python
     # 将’Age’列转换为整数
     df[‘Age’] = df[‘Age’].astype(int)

# 显示数据类型
     print(df.dtypes)
     ```

三、进阶技巧

  1. 性能优化:对于大数据集,可以使用chunksize参数分块读取数据。
  2. 异常处理:在读取过程中可能会遇到各种错误,如文件不存在或格式错误等,需要编写适当的错误处理逻辑。
  3. 数据清理:读取数据后,通常需要进行预处理,如删除重复项和处理异常值等。

总之,通过上述步骤,可以有效地读取并处理Excel文件中的数据。随着经验的积累,可以探索更多关于数据处理和分析的方法。


文章转载自:
http://tarantella.zpfr.cn
http://cancellate.zpfr.cn
http://shapka.zpfr.cn
http://decoct.zpfr.cn
http://menispermaceous.zpfr.cn
http://bdsc.zpfr.cn
http://sombrero.zpfr.cn
http://repoint.zpfr.cn
http://deckle.zpfr.cn
http://nov.zpfr.cn
http://wais.zpfr.cn
http://gynaeolatry.zpfr.cn
http://thundrous.zpfr.cn
http://unobtrusive.zpfr.cn
http://biafran.zpfr.cn
http://biologic.zpfr.cn
http://kora.zpfr.cn
http://dogfall.zpfr.cn
http://laryngoscope.zpfr.cn
http://cycloid.zpfr.cn
http://univalvular.zpfr.cn
http://awhirl.zpfr.cn
http://oer.zpfr.cn
http://paddock.zpfr.cn
http://lumpsucker.zpfr.cn
http://gustaf.zpfr.cn
http://biffin.zpfr.cn
http://metarhodopsin.zpfr.cn
http://soberize.zpfr.cn
http://zinkenite.zpfr.cn
http://osteocope.zpfr.cn
http://spinous.zpfr.cn
http://satyagraha.zpfr.cn
http://heinie.zpfr.cn
http://participation.zpfr.cn
http://autotelegraph.zpfr.cn
http://claytonia.zpfr.cn
http://schefflera.zpfr.cn
http://mugful.zpfr.cn
http://corresponsive.zpfr.cn
http://happenstantial.zpfr.cn
http://ossiferous.zpfr.cn
http://local.zpfr.cn
http://trapes.zpfr.cn
http://seder.zpfr.cn
http://pussley.zpfr.cn
http://ossie.zpfr.cn
http://vinegarette.zpfr.cn
http://formalistic.zpfr.cn
http://gadgeteering.zpfr.cn
http://catapult.zpfr.cn
http://kennetjie.zpfr.cn
http://laptev.zpfr.cn
http://metempirical.zpfr.cn
http://vibrio.zpfr.cn
http://pelasgi.zpfr.cn
http://calendar.zpfr.cn
http://guesstimate.zpfr.cn
http://ingush.zpfr.cn
http://cambodian.zpfr.cn
http://colophony.zpfr.cn
http://prey.zpfr.cn
http://landside.zpfr.cn
http://wga.zpfr.cn
http://arpa.zpfr.cn
http://insalivation.zpfr.cn
http://touchily.zpfr.cn
http://daredeviltry.zpfr.cn
http://flake.zpfr.cn
http://algebraize.zpfr.cn
http://soothing.zpfr.cn
http://seel.zpfr.cn
http://groan.zpfr.cn
http://arrears.zpfr.cn
http://ascesis.zpfr.cn
http://hoodie.zpfr.cn
http://esau.zpfr.cn
http://garefowl.zpfr.cn
http://inspectorate.zpfr.cn
http://slumlord.zpfr.cn
http://shovelhead.zpfr.cn
http://agranulocyte.zpfr.cn
http://evolutional.zpfr.cn
http://photomixing.zpfr.cn
http://hydrocellulose.zpfr.cn
http://kabul.zpfr.cn
http://encode.zpfr.cn
http://moot.zpfr.cn
http://superhelix.zpfr.cn
http://depreciate.zpfr.cn
http://spidery.zpfr.cn
http://piece.zpfr.cn
http://lathyritic.zpfr.cn
http://subungulate.zpfr.cn
http://exarch.zpfr.cn
http://secta.zpfr.cn
http://kudzu.zpfr.cn
http://underlining.zpfr.cn
http://skep.zpfr.cn
http://raptorial.zpfr.cn
http://www.dt0577.cn/news/105499.html

相关文章:

  • 网站短信验证码怎么做百度广告投放平台
  • 坦洲网站建设营销课程
  • 东营网络营销seo搜索引擎优化策略
  • 网站中怎么做网站统计沈阳百度推广哪家好
  • 律师微网站制作网站怎样做推广
  • 广告设计接单网站百度指数入口
  • 有哪些网站的搜索引擎seo优化主要工作内容
  • 深圳西乡网站建设专业模板建站
  • 如何在电脑上建立网站大数据营销成功案例
  • 公司网站如何做水印个人博客登录入口
  • 福州最好的网站建设站长之家查询工具
  • 曲靖网站建设dodocoseo最新教程
  • 重庆关键词seo排名seo自然排名
  • 网站制作及排名优化百度工具seo
  • 个人静态网站首页怎么做国外免费源码共享网站
  • 好的公司网站上海培训机构整顿
  • 台州做网站联系方式seo教程seo官网优化详细方法
  • 网站收录提交入口怎么做dz论坛seo
  • 房屋经纪人网站端口怎么做脚上起小水泡还很痒是什么原因
  • 网站css样式下载制作网站建设入门
  • WordPress开启自带redis东莞营销网站建设优化
  • 常州互联网公司长沙seo推广
  • 全新的手机网站设计军事新闻最新消息
  • soho 网站建设推广引流方法与渠道
  • 怎样低成本做网站推广企业seo顾问服务阿亮
  • 网站制作案例湖北网站推广
  • 政府网站建设方向百度怎么发布广告
  • 做投票页面什么网站好黄页网站推广公司
  • 站外推广营销方案百度推广客户端手机版下载
  • 网站建设几层结构营销型网站策划方案